Who we are
Short intro about JMA, when it was founded, philosophy, etc. Lorem ipsum meu cursus ligula. Phasellus sed justo a ex molestie lobortis. Fusce a est aliquam, rhoncus tortor at, cursus ipsum.
Our Team

Ben Walpole
Associate Senior Software Developer
Ben is a full-stack application developer based in London, UK. He has a range of experience building collaboration and data tools for charities and community groups in the UK. Ben joined the CiviCRM Core Team in 2024 and has worked with them on the CiviCRM Standalone and ChartKit initiatives.
In his spare time Ben likes fixing bikes, playing basketball, and reading the London Review of Books.

Edsel Lopez
Software Engineering Manager
Edsel Lopez has been helping JMA Consulting’s clients since 2012. He started as a full stack CiviCRM and Drupal developer, then grew to handle WordPress, Joomla and other technologies. As Software Engineering Manager since 2022, Edsel supervises the development team and ensures that client needs are accurately reflected in technical requirements and the solution works well when delivered to them.
When relaxing outside work Edsel enjoys gaming and walks with his dog, Mayo.

Joe Murray
President
Joe has over 25 years of experience providing technology solutions to non-profits. He is a co-author of Using CiviCRM (574pp), a moderator of https://civicrm.stackexchange.com and a member of the CiviCRM Community Council. Joe has been on the Board of ten local and provincial non-profits that provided services and advocated for change.
In his spare time Joe enjoys hiking, snowshoeing and masters swimming.

Monish Deb
Senior Consultant
Monish Deb’s responsibilities include ongoing contributions to core CiviCRM code, and delivering WordPress/CiviCRM and Drupal/CiviCRM solutions for JMA clients. He has published mobile applications for JMA clients and is always keen to learn new skills and adapt to new technology.
He is currently among the top six contributors to CiviCRM.

Olapeju Kazeem
Associate Front-End Developer
Olapeju Kazeem is a Front-End Developer at JMA Consulting. She brings her keen eye for design, her user-first focus, and her technical aptitude to develop modern custom WordPress/CiviCRM themes that delight our clients.
Olapeju also brings her joy of lifelong learning (specifically languages and technologies) and her love to travel to the JMA team.

Seamus Lee
Chief Security Officer | Senior Consultant
Seamus is a Senior Consultant at JMA Consulting based in Sydney, Australia. His responsibilities include ongoing contributions to core CiviCRM code and security fixes, and delivering WordPress/CiviCRM and Drupal/CiviCRM solutions to JMA clients. He is the Technical Lead on JMA’s hosting and bulk hosting platforms.
Seamus is the CiviCRM Security Team Lead and a member of the CiviCRM Core Team.
He enjoys learning new technologies, has expertise in OAuth 2.0, React, Terraform and Apache Solr, and a passion for politics.
We're driven by
Optional text field here to talk about vision, mission and values as a whole, if needed.

Our vision
To help organizations with a significant reach and mission build their capacity to make a social impact using collaboratively created open source solutions.

Our values
- Serve as trusted advisors
- Listen attentively and with discernment
- Make decisions collaboratively
- Present achievable recommendations
- Achieve excellent results scaled to the resources available
- Deliver enterprise-level service and solutions
- Cultivate long-term relationships
- Be good open-source citizens

Our mission
We collaborate with our clients to create effective digital strategies and open source solutions that help them achieve their mission and magnify their impact – building their capacity from the inside out.
Join us
Copy about career opportunities with JMA and why it’s a cool team to join, rewarding work, etc. Lorem ipsum meu cursus ligula. Phasellus sed justo a ex molestie lobortis. Fusce a est aliquam, rhoncus tortor at, cursus ipsum fusce a est aliquam, rhoncus tortor at, cursus ipsum.
